Philosopher

A philosopher is a person devoted to studying and producing results in philosophy. The word, "philosopher", literally means "lover of wisdom".

Nicknames of Medieval Philosophers

Several medieval philosophers have been given Latin nicknames by historians. For example:

  • Francis Mayron - Doctor acutus, the acute doctor, or Doctor illuminatus
  • St. Thomas Aquinas - Doctor Angelicus, the angelic doctor, or Doctor Communis
  • William of Ockham - Doctor Invincibilis
  • Alexander of Hales - Doctor Irrefragibilis
  • Roger Bacon - Doctor Mirabilis, the wonderful doctor
  • John Bassol - Doctor Ordinatissimus, the most methodical doctor
  • St. Bonaventure - Doctor Seraphicus
  • Henry Goethals (Hendricus Bonicollius) - Doctor Solemnis, the solemn doctor
  • Richard Middleton - the solid doctor, or the profound doctor
  • Duns Scotus - Doctor Subtilis, the discriminating doctor, or Doctor Marianus
  • Albertus Magnus - Doctor Universalis
  • Durandus de Sancto Portiano - the most resolute doctor
  • Thomas Bradwardine - the profound doctor
  • Jean Ruysbroeck (Joannes Ruysbrokius) - the divine doctor
